A scattered volume emitter micropixel architecture for ultraefficient light extraction from DUV LEDs

Faris Azim Ahmad Fajri,
Anjan Mukherjee,
Suraj Naskar
et al.

Abstract: Deep ultraviolet light-emitting diodes (DUV LEDs) typically suffer from strong parasitic absorption in the p-epitaxial layer and rear metal contact/mirror. This problem is exacerbated by a significant portion of the multiquantum well (MQW) emissions having a strong out-of-plane dipole component, contributing to emission in widely oblique directions outside the exit cone of the emitting surface. Here, an architecture that exploits heavy oblique emission is proposed by using scattered volume emitter micropixels … Show more
